在 2025/2/25 00:59, Tao Chen 写道:
More and more kfunc functions are being added to the kernel.
Different prog types have different restrictions when using kfunc.
Therefore, prog_kfunc probe is added to check whether it is supported,
and the use of this api will be added to bpftool later.

The script:
#!/bin/python3

import os
import re
from collections import defaultdict

# Regular expression to match register_btf_kfunc_id_set calls (supports multi-line)
register_pattern = re.compile(
r'register_btf_kfunc_id_set\s*\(\s*(BPF_PROG_TYPE_\w+)\s*,' # Match function name and first argument
    r'[\s\S]*?&(\w+)\s*\)',  # Match second argument (supports multi-line)
    re.DOTALL  # Enable multi-line matching
)

# Regular expression to match struct variable definitions and .set initialization
struct_var_pattern = re.compile(
r'static\s+const\s+struct\s+btf_kfunc_id_set\s+' # Match struct variable definition r'(\w+)\s*=\s*\{.*?\.set\s*=\s*&(\w+)\s*,.*?\};', # Match .set initialization
    re.DOTALL  # Enable multi-line matching
)

# Regular expression to match BTF_KFUNCS_START and BTF_KFUNCS_END blocks
btf_kfuncs_pattern = re.compile(
    r'BTF_KFUNCS_START\s*\(\s*(\w+)\s*\)'  # Match BTF_KFUNCS_START
    r'([\s\S]*?)'  # Match any content (non-greedy)
r'BTF_KFUNCS_END\s*\(\s*\1\s*\)', # Match BTF_KFUNCS_END with the same parameter
    re.DOTALL  # Enable multi-line matching
)

# Regular expression to match BTF_ID_FLAGS(func, ...) declared functions
btf_id_flags_pattern = re.compile(
r'BTF_ID_FLAGS\s*\(\s*func\s*,\s*(\w+)\s*(?:,\s*.*?)?\)' # Match function name
)

# Dictionary to store functions and their corresponding prog_types
func_prog_types = defaultdict(set)

# Set of prog_types to exclude
excluded_prog_types = {
    "TRACING",
    "EXT",
    "LSM",
    "STRUCT_OPS",
}

def scan_file(file_path):
    """
Scan a single file to find register_btf_kfunc_id_set calls and further scan for struct variables and BTF_KFUNCS blocks.
    """
    with open(file_path, 'r', encoding='utf-8', errors='ignore') as file:
        content = file.read()
        content = content.replace('\r\n', '\n')

        # Find register_btf_kfunc_id_set calls
        register_matches = register_pattern.findall(content)
        for prog_type, kfunc_set in register_matches:
            # Remove BPF_PROG_TYPE_ prefix
            prog_type_short = prog_type.replace("BPF_PROG_TYPE_", "")

            # Skip excluded prog_types
            if prog_type_short in excluded_prog_types:
                continue

            print(f"File: {file_path}")
            print(f"  prog_type: {prog_type_short}")
            print(f"  kfunc_set: {kfunc_set}")

            # Find struct variables with the same name
            struct_var_matches = struct_var_pattern.findall(content)
            found = False
            for struct_var_name, set_name in struct_var_matches:
                if struct_var_name == kfunc_set:
                    print(f"  Struct variable: {struct_var_name}")
                    print(f"  .set initialized with: {set_name}")
                    found = True

                    # Find BTF_KFUNCS_START and BTF_KFUNCS_END blocks
btf_kfuncs_matches = btf_kfuncs_pattern.findall(content)
                    #print(btf_kfuncs_matches)
                    if btf_kfuncs_matches:
                        for func, block_content in btf_kfuncs_matches:
                            if func == set_name:
                                #block_content = btf_kfuncs_match.group(2)
print(f" BTF_KFUNCS block found for {set_name}")

# Extract functions declared in BTF_ID_FLAGS(func, ...) func_matches = btf_id_flags_pattern.findall(block_content)
                                if func_matches:
                                    print("  Functions declared in block:")
                                    for func_name in func_matches:
print(f" {func_name} (prog_type: {prog_type_short})") # Record function and its corresponding prog_type func_prog_types[func_name].add(prog_type_short)
                                else:
                                    print("  No functions found in block")
                    else:
print(f" No BTF_KFUNCS block found for {set_name}")

                    break

            if not found:
print(f" No matching struct variable found for {kfunc_set}")

            print("-" * 40)

def scan_repository(repo_path):
    """
Traverse all .c and .h files in the repository and call scan_file for each file.
    """
    for root, dirs, files in os.walk(repo_path):
        # Exclude selftest directory
        if "selftests" in dirs:
            dirs.remove("selftests")

        for file_name in files:
            if file_name.endswith(('.c', '.h')):
                file_path = os.path.join(root, file_name)
                scan_file(file_path)

def print_func_prog_types():
    print("\nSummary of functions and their corresponding prog_types:")
    for func_name, prog_types in func_prog_types.items():
        print(f"{func_name}: {', '.join(prog_types)}")

if __name__ == "__main__":
repo_path = "/home/dylane/sdb/bpf-next2/bpf-next" # Replace with your repository path

    print(f"Scanning repository: {repo_path}")
    scan_repository(repo_path)

    print_func_prog_types()

the c code:
static const struct {
	const char *name;
	int code;
} program_types[] = {
#define _T(n) { #n, BPF_PROG_TYPE_ ## n }
	_T(KPROBE),
	_T(XDP),
	_T(SYSCALL),
	_T(SCHED_CLS),
	_T(SCHED_ACT),
	_T(SK_SKB),
	_T(SOCKET_FILTER),
	_T(CGROUP_SKB),
	_T(LWT_OUT),
	_T(LWT_IN),
	_T(LWT_XMIT),
	_T(LWT_SEG6LOCAL),
	_T(NETFILTER)
#undef _T
};

void test_libbpf_probe_kfuncs_many(void)
{
	int i, kfunc_id, ret, id;
	const struct btf_type *t;
	struct btf *btf = NULL;
	const char *kfunc;
	const char *tag;

	btf = btf__parse("/sys/kernel/btf/vmlinux", NULL);
	if (!ASSERT_OK_PTR(btf, "btf_parse"))
		return;
	for (id = 0; id < btf__type_cnt(btf); ++id) {
		t = btf__type_by_id(btf, id);
		if (!t)
			continue;
		if (!btf_is_decl_tag(t))
			continue;
		tag = btf__name_by_offset(btf, t->name_off);
		if (strcmp(tag, "bpf_kfunc") != 0)
			continue;
		kfunc_id = t->type;
		t = btf__type_by_id(btf, kfunc_id);
		if (!btf_is_func(t))
			continue;
		kfunc = btf__name_by_offset(btf, t->name_off);
		printf("[%-6d] %-42s ", kfunc_id, kfunc);
		for (i = 0; i < ARRAY_SIZE(program_types); ++i) {
			ret = libbpf_probe_bpf_kfunc(program_types[i].code, kfunc_id, -1, NULL);
			if (ret < 0)
				printf("%-2d  ", ret);
			else if (ret == 0)
				printf("%2s", "");
			else
				printf("%2s  ", program_types[i].name);
		}
		printf("\n");
	}
	btf__free(btf);
}
